Cheesman Park is one of Denver’s densest, most-rented pockets — a wall of 1920s courtyard apartments, mid-century mid-rises, and grand old buildings facing the park. They’re full of character and full of renters cycling in and out, which means a steady stream of couches, mattresses, and move-out piles that have to get down and out. Here’s the plan.

What makes Cheesman Park moves tricky

  • Vintage buildings, tiny elevators. Many of Cheesman’s historic buildings have a small original elevator that won’t fit a couch — or no elevator at all, just narrow interior stairs.
  • Narrow halls and doorways. Older floor plans mean tight turns between the unit and the exit.
  • Permit-zone street parking. Like neighboring Capitol Hill, much of Cheesman is residential permit parking — tight and competitive for a loading window.
  • High turnover. Leases move fast here, so cleanouts are often on a same-day timeline.

The building dumpster isn’t for furniture

Cheesman’s apartment dumpsters are for household bags, not couches, mattresses, or electronics — and Colorado bans mattresses and e-waste from the landfill anyway. Leaving big items by the bins can get the building an illegal-dumping fine. Have them hauled.
